Seedance 2.5 is ByteDance's flagship video model. It is built for photographic motion (skin, materials, camera moves that read as filmed) and it writes a native soundtrack in the same take, including dialogue. You can feed up to 30 references (stills, clips, a look) so a character or product does not drift after a few seconds. It also edits an existing clip: restage, extend, or rewrite the action. Getting the most out of Seedance 2.5

  • Write a shot list, not a mood. Name the lens (35mm, 85mm), the move (locked off, slow dolly in, handheld), and the light (soft window, hard noon). Seedance 2.5 reads photographic direction better than filter words.
  • If you want native audio, put the line and the room in the prompt: who speaks, how loud, what the room sounds like (HVAC, street, quiet interior). Leave audio unspecified only when you plan to replace it.
  • For reference-to-video, label each still or clip: hero face, product pack, wardrobe, color grade. Up to 30 refs help only if they agree. Conflicting outfits or lighting make the hold drift after a few seconds.
  • Time the action to the clip. A 5-second keep is one beat. A 15-second keep needs a start, a turn, and an exit. Stacking three camera moves in five seconds reads as a glitch.
  • When you drop in a clip to edit, say what must stay (talent, framing, product) and what to rewrite (action, dialogue, camera). A vague restyle prompt will move the face.
  • Avoid painterly or anime language, and do not stack opposing camera directions. Seedance 2.5 is built for filmed skin and materials. Contradictory adjectives (static and whip-pan) waste a keep.
